Spinnaker and pole for E 32-2

My E32-2 came with a spinnaker pole and a symmetrical sail. We have no hope in hell to use this not knowing how to do the pole with only two people as crew. I can take pics of the sail and pole for anyone that might want this. It's in Northern NJ. If anyone is interested -- make me an offer. I wouldn't know what to ask for this. Proceeds from the sale will probably go towards getting an asymmetrical cruising gennaker, so that;s the plan.

Before you sell your spin. Consider a ATN Tacker . You can fly the spin without a pole even singlehanded as I do
on my 35-2.
